Transaction 64c183f97875fde14a31597920580a868bdccd7067d4e64d5e17f42458e76905
1 Input
1 Output
-
64c183f97875fde14a31597920580a868bdccd7067d4e64d5e17f42458e76905:0
- value
- 72605999
- script pubkey
- OP_0 OP_PUSHBYTES_20 689d993f2849cc3bf7f930f00aae6004da1c306b
- address
- bc1qdzwej0egf8xrhalexrcq4tnqqndpcvrt0c5nd4